filters:163 size:15 KB
Clear All Filters
Brook Taverner Purple Tailored Fit Diamond Print Shirt
£50
M&Co Purple Petite Dobby Short Sleeve Boho Shirt
£30
Joe Browns Purple Paisley Print Shirt
£45
Aspiga Purple Cosima Viscose Crepe Printed Shirt
£120
FatFace Carolin Plum Purple Check Shirt
£52
FatFace Bessie Plum Purple Check Shirt
£49.50